Jean Dépont is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Anthropology and Paleontology. According to data from OpenAlex, Jean Dépont has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 335 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Atmospheric Science, 4 papers in Anthropology and 3 papers in Paleontology. Recurrent topics in Jean Dépont’s work include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(5 papers), Pleistocene-Era Hominins and Archaeology (4 papers) and Archaeology and ancient environmental studies (3 papers). Jean Dépont is often cited by papers focused on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(5 papers), Pleistocene-Era Hominins and Archaeology (4 papers) and Archaeology and ancient environmental studies (3 papers). Jean Dépont collaborates with scholars based in France, Italy and Japan. Jean Dépont's co-authors include Jean‐Jacques Bahain, Pierre Voinchet, Jackie Despriée, Christophe Falguères, Hélène Tissoux, Jean‐Michel Dolo, Robert Gageonnet, Gilles Courcimault, Simon Puaud and Salah Abdessadok and has published in prestigious journals such as Quaternary Science Reviews, Quaternary International and Quaternary Geochronology.
